File Description:
This project features the Blue Mesa Reservoir and the Black Canyon of the Gunnison and adds over 300 highly detailed lakes to the central portion of western Colorado. Three reservoirs, named for corresponding dams on the Gunnison River, form the heart of Curecanti National Recreation Area. Panoramic mesas, fjord-like reservoirs, and deep, steep and narrow canyons abound. Blue Mesa Reservoir is Colorado's largest body of water, and is the largest Kokanee Salmon fishery in the United States. Morrow Point Reservoir is the beginning of the Black Canyon of the Gunnison and below it is Crystal Reservoir.
These lakes are specifically designed to show off their photo realistic detail when used in combination with "FSGenesis-The Rockies 38.2m Terrain Mesh-Colorado" available as "fsg_dem38m_usrk_co.zip" at avsim.com, or comparable mesh. The free FSGenesis US National Landclass Project Beta 6 also adds beautifully to the landscape. These lakes work equally as well with the default mesh.
All lake information was projected from satellite imagery and compiled with a beta version of Jim Keir's "Slartibartfast" utility. Much thanks to Holger Sandmann and Jim Keir for their help and advice on interpreting the satellite data properly.

File Description:
The Bloukrans and Paul Sauer (over the Storms river) bridges are on the N2 highway between Plettenberg Bay and Port Elizabeth on the scenic garden route in the Eastern Cape, South Africa. I made the custom scenery to try some Blender techniques using the P3D 4.5 SDK and tested it in P3D V5 using the ORBX Africa LC and Pilots NG2020 mesh products (I included a fix for the default V5 mesh). You will find the world's highest commercial bungee jump from the Bloukrans bridge, 216m above the river below. Take off from FAPG and fly a heading of 95 degrees for 32 km to get to the Bloukrans bridge (just off the coast). Follow the highway further east for another 26 km to get to the 120m high Paul Sauer bridge, where I included some additional eye candy.

File Description:
In June 1939 a survey was carried out for a route between Australia and Great Britain in the event of war cutting the existing path through the Middle and Far East. Cpt. P. G. Taylor proposed a path across the Indian Ocean to Mombasa via Cocos Island, Diego Garcia and the Seychelles. On June 4th. the survey flight departed Port Hedland aboard the PBY-1 "Guba". In a similar fashion, Imperial Airways planned a "Reserve" route from Britain to Mombasa via Lisbon, the Canaries, Bathurst (West Africa) and Lagos. It is not known if this route was used in full or in part. This package includes two flights covering the entire route, one for the Imperial Airways section and the other for the "Guba" survey flight.

File Description:
Our journey commences in May 1932 at Embaba airport (Cairo) and the Flight Simulator flight-plan shows the route all the way to Cape Town. You will, of course, pause for refuelling and overnight stops during this 7-day epic from the top of Africa to the very southern tip of the continent. Imperial Airways operated the Handley Page HP42 between Cairo and Nairobi and the Armstrong Whitworth AW15 "Atalanta" for the second half of the journey. The flight has been saved with the Flight Simulator 2004 default Cessna 172 to enable a trouble-free commencement.
